「javagui查询」Javagui查询数据库数据

博主:adminadmin 2023-01-17 08:27:07 378

今天给各位分享javagui查询的知识,其中也会对Javagui查询数据库数据进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!

本文目录一览:

java用GUI技术和JDBC技术怎么编写查询商品信息源代码 急急急啊

JDBC使用Connection进行连接数据库 写 select查询语句 GUI主要用来显示。。

为什么把java的gui应用程序中数据库的查询结果数据集resutset转换成vector类

支持线程的同步,即某一时刻只有一个线程能够写Vector,避免多线程同时写而引起的不一致性你的采纳是我前进的动力,还有不懂的地方,请继续“追问”。

如你还有别的问题,可另外向我求助;答题不易,互相理解,互相帮助。

java编写的GUI 怎么实现查找功能(使用搜索栏搜索)

文本框+搜索按钮。

获取输入的内容,从数据库中查找,显示即可。

java编写的GUI 怎么实现查找功能(使用搜索栏搜索) 还是这个问题

最近都没怎么来这里 不好意思这么久才回你

我猜你测试的时候是键入的这些内容

是这样的:

在我们键入回车键的时候,实际上生成的是两个字符:一个是换行键(ASCII码13),一个是回车键(ASCII码10)

然后用indexOf查找的时候 每多一个回车 实际上多出一个字符

而在highlighter 渲染的时候 会认为这两个字符是一个字符

所以就会每行下错一个

把你的这行:

String textInText = text.getText();

改成:

String textInText = text.getText().replaceAll(String.valueOf((char) 13), "");

text.setText(textInText);

这样就可以了

暂时怀疑这是HighLighter的bug 等我腾出时间来仔细看看类库里边怎么写的吧

java编写的GUI 怎么实现查找功能(使用搜索

java编写的GUI 怎么实现查找功能:

package communitys.Connect;

import java.awt.event.ActionEvent;

import java.awt.event.ActionListener;

import java.sql.Connection;

import java.sql.DriverManager;

import java.sql.ResultSet;

import java.sql.SQLException;

import java.sql.Statement;

import javax.swing.JButton;

import javax.swing.JFrame;

import javax.swing.JPasswordField;

import javax.swing.JTextField;

public class dxdsy extends JFrame implements ActionListener{

private JButton button = new JButton("搜索");

private JTextField textfile = new JPasswordField("请输入文件名称······");

public dxdsy()

{

this.setLayout(null);

this.setBounds(200,200, 500,500);

textfile.setBounds(1, 1, 100,20);

button.setBounds(1, 25, 80,80);

this.add(button);

this.add(textfile);

button.addActionListener(this);//添加事件监听

this.setVisible(true);

}

public static void main(String[] args) {

// TODO Auto-generated method stub

}

public void actionPerformed(ActionEvent e) {

String sql = "select * from tablename where 条件 like '%"+textfile.getText()+"%'";

try {

Class.forName("驱动字符");

Connection conn = DriverManager.getConnection("驱动字符");

Statement sta = conn.createStatement();

ResultSet rs = sta.executeQuery(sql);

//这个rs集合当中就是想要的数据

} catch (ClassNotFoundException e1) {

// TODO Auto-generated catch block

e1.printStackTrace();

} catch (SQLException e2) {

// TODO Auto-generated catch block

e2.printStackTrace();

}

}

}

java GUI开发,想把从数据库查询输出的数据用表格显示出来用什么组件?

首先用java GUI 开发的话,需要继承或者新建JFrame(或者Frame f )如果你想输出,需要使用ScrollPane sp,JTable tb ~~~~然后sp.add(tb);f.add(sp);其实输出还要连接数据库还蛮复杂的。具体就不写了哈~~

javagui查询的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于Javagui查询数据库数据、javagui查询的信息别忘了在本站进行查找喔。